RosterIn commented on a change in pull request #6578: [DEPENDS ON #6575][DEPENDS ON #6577][AIRFLOW-5907] Add S3 to MySql Operator URL: https://github.com/apache/airflow/pull/6578#discussion_r347757745
########## File path: airflow/operators/s3_to_mysql.py ########## @@ -0,0 +1,65 @@ +from airflow.hooks.mysql_hook import MySqlHook +from airflow.models import BaseOperator +from airflow.providers.aws.hooks.s3 import S3Hook +from airflow.utils.decorators import apply_defaults + + +class S3ToMySqlTransfer(BaseOperator): + """ + Loads a file from S3 into a MySQL table. Review comment: You can follow how it works in MySqlToGoogleCloudStorageOperator https://github.com/apache/airflow/blob/master/airflow/operators/mysql_to_gcs.py#L36 It support both Json and csv Personally I really like the idea of BaseSQLToGoogleCloudStorageOperator as I believe it's the same case here but that's your call. ---------------------------------------------------------------- This is an automated message from the Apache Git Service. To respond to the message, please log on to GitHub and use the URL above to go to the specific comment. For queries about this service, please contact Infrastructure at: us...@infra.apache.org With regards, Apache Git Services